ROSS TOWNSHIP, Ohio - WLWT.com
Officers are looking for three men believed to be involved in a Friday morning bank robbery.
Investigators said three men, one carrying a gun, entered a Fifth-Third bank branch on Hamilton-Cleves Road just before 10 a.m. and demanded money.
Police said the armed man may have tried to fire the gun, but it failed to go off.

The men were last seen fleeing the scene in a large black car, possible a Ford Crown Victoria.
No injuries were reported.
